Peppara Dam is a masonry gravity dam located on the Karamana River in the Thiruvananthapuram district of Kerala. The dam offers a breathtaking view of the lush green surroundings and hills. The dam was built by the Kerala Water Authority in 1983 and has a catchment area of 83 square kilometers. The dam is 423 meters long and unifies all upper tributaries of the Karamana River, and regulates water flow to Aruvikkara to suit the needs of Trivandrum city. The dam receives an average rainfall of 481 centimeters and has a reservoir area of 5.82 square kilometers.
Peppara Dam is a significant landmark and provides drinking water to the city of Thiruvananthapuram and is also a part of the Peppara Wildlife Sanctuary, which is one of the popular wildlife sanctuaries in Kerala and among the must-visit sightseeing places in Ponmudi. The sanctuary derives its name from Peppara Dam and consists of the catchment area of the Karamana River, which originates from Chemmunjimottai, the tallest hill within the sanctuary. Visitors to the sanctuary can trek to Vazhvanthol Waterfalls, which is a gorgeous panoramic view of the entire valley, and Peppara Dam, a quaint little picnic spot.
The best time to visit Peppara Dam and the wildlife sanctuary is from October to March when the weather is pleasant and dry. There is no entry fee for Peppara Dam and is open from 9 AM to 5 PM all days of the week. The dam is located 35 kilometers away from Thiruvananthapuram city and is easily reachable by road. Peppara is connected well by the highways to the other parts of Kerala and is easily accessible from Vithura on Trivandrum – Ponmudi road. Regular bus services are available from the major cities of Kerala via Trivandrum. The nearest railway station is Thiruvananthapuram Central which is located 37 kilometers away and the closest airport is Thiruvananthapuram International Airport which is located 40 kilometers away from Peppara Dam.
